What​ ​Is​ ​The​ ​Origin​ ​And​ ​Meaning​ ​Of​ ​XOXO?​ ​We​’​ll​ ​Kiss​ ​And​ ​Tell​!​

 

From​ ​Valentine​’​s​ ​Day​ ​cards​ ​to​ ​messages​ ​from​ ​your​ ​mom,​ ​a​ ​typical​ ​sign-off​ ​to​ ​show​ ​love​ ​and​ ​affection​ ​is​ ​XOXO.​ ​The​ ​X​ ​stands​ ​for​ ​kiss​ ​and​ ​the​ ​O​ ​stands​ ​for​ ​a​ ​hug​—​but​ ​why?​ ​Well,​ ​the​ ​origins​ ​of​ ​these​ ​symbols​ ​is​ ​uncertain,​ ​but​ ​we​ ​can​ ​make​ ​some​ ​educated​ ​guesses​ ​about​ ​where​ ​they​ ​come​ ​from.

 

Why​ ​is​ ​X​ ​the​ ​symbol​ ​for​ ​a​ ​kiss?

The​ ​use​ ​of​ ​X​ ​as​ ​a​ ​symbol​ ​is​ ​believed​ ​to​ ​date​ ​back​ ​to​ ​the​ ​Middle​ ​Ages,​ ​when​ ​most​ ​people​ ​were​ ​not​ ​literate.​ ​They​ ​would​ ​use​ ​the​ ​letter​ ​X​—​or​ ​a​ ​cross​—​to​ ​sign​ ​documents​ ​as​ ​a​ ​display​ ​of​ ​faith​ ​and​ ​indication​ ​of​ ​their​ ​sincerity.​ ​They​’​d​ ​also​ ​kiss​ ​the​ ​cross​ ​as​ ​another​ ​symbol​ ​of​ ​trustworthiness:​ ​a​ ​literal​ ​“​seal​ ​with​ ​a​ ​kiss.​”​ ​In​ ​these​ ​instances,​ ​the​ ​X​ ​represented​ ​the​ ​sign​ ​of​ ​the​ ​cross​ ​and​ ​Christ​ ​because​ ​of​ ​its​ ​connection​ ​to​ ​the​ ​Chi-Rho,​ ​a​ ​Christian​ ​symbol.​ ​The​ ​first​ ​two​ ​letters​ ​of​ ​Christ​ ​in​ ​Greek​ ​(Χ​Ρ​Ι​Σ​Τ​Ο​Σ)​ ​are​ ​chi​ ​and​ ​rho,​ ​and​ ​chi​ ​looks​ ​like​ ​X.

 

It​’​s​ ​possible​ ​that​ ​the​ ​X​ ​also​ ​became​ ​connected​ ​with​ ​kissing​ ​because​ ​it​ ​looks​ ​like​ ​two​ ​puckered​ ​lips.​ ​No​ ​matter​ ​its​ ​history,​ ​the​ ​letter​ ​X​ ​was​ ​used​ ​in​ ​letters​ ​to​ ​symbolize​ ​a​ ​kiss​ ​back​ ​in​ ​the​ ​1700s.​

 

Why​ ​is​ ​O​ ​the​ ​symbol​ ​for​ ​a​ ​hug?

The​ ​origins​ ​of​ ​how​ ​O​ ​came​ ​to​ ​represent​ ​a​ ​hug​ ​are​ ​even​ ​more​ ​uncertain,​ ​though​ ​some​ ​connect​ ​its​ ​use​ ​to​ ​illiterate​ ​Jewish​ ​immigrants​ ​who​ ​came​ ​to​ ​the​ ​US​ ​who​ ​may​ ​have​ ​signed​ ​documents​ ​with​ ​an​ ​O.​ ​They​ ​did​ ​this​ ​in​ ​contrast​ ​to​ ​the​ ​Christian​ ​X.​ ​Eventually​ ​the​ ​letter​ ​came​ ​to​ ​represent​ ​a​ ​hug.

 

Another​ ​possibility​ ​is​ ​that​ ​the​ ​O​ ​is​ ​used​ ​to​ ​represent​ ​hugs​ ​because​ ​it​ ​simply​ ​looks​ ​like​ ​someone​ ​encircling​ ​their​ ​arms​ ​in​ ​a​ ​hugging​ ​gesture.​ ​It​’​s​ ​also​ ​possible​ ​that​ ​the​ ​O​ ​came​ ​to​ ​mean​ ​“​hug​”​ ​because​ ​of​ ​its​ ​prior​ ​association​ ​with​ ​X​ ​from​ ​the​ ​game​ ​tic-tac-toe.

 

The​ ​practice​ ​of​ ​pairing​ ​O​ ​with​ ​X​ ​as​ ​a​ ​sign-off​ ​in​ ​a​ ​letter​ ​as​ ​XOXO​ ​is​ ​a​ ​fairly​ ​modern​ ​one​ ​and​ ​didn​’​t​ ​see​ ​widespread​ ​use​ ​until​ ​the​ ​1960s.​ ​The​ ​TV​ ​series​ ​Gossip​ ​Girl​ ​also​ ​popularized​ ​its​ ​use,​ ​as​ ​each​ ​episode​ ​ended​ ​with​ ​a​ ​signature​ ​voiceover,​ ​“​XOXO,​ ​Gossip​ ​Girl.​”

 

Despite​ ​the​ ​complicated​ ​origins​ ​of​ ​these​ ​symbols,​ ​these​ ​days​ ​it​ ​is​ ​widely​ ​accepted​ ​that​ ​XOXO​ ​means​ ​“​hugs​ ​and​ ​kisses.​”​ ​In​ ​the​ ​United​ ​Kingdom,​ ​use​ ​of​ ​XX​ ​(​meaning​ ​“​kisses​”​)​ ​as​ ​a​ ​sign-off​ ​is​ ​particularly​ ​popular,​ ​though​ ​the​ ​practice​ ​remains​ ​less​ ​common​ ​in​ ​North​ ​America,​ ​where​ ​XOXO​ ​is​ ​the​ ​more​ ​common​ ​formulation.
